Caption
The James Webb Space Telescope’s mid-infrared image of galaxies IC 2163 and NGC 2207 recalls the iciness of long-dead bones mixed with eerie vapors. Two large luminous “eyes” lie at the galaxies’ cores, and gauzy spiral arms reach out into the vast distances of space.
Webb’s mid-infrared image excels at showing where the cold dust glows throughout these galaxies — and helps pinpoint where stars and star clusters are buried within the dust. Find these regions by looking for the pink dots along the spiral arms. Many of these areas are home to actively forming stars that are still encased in the gas and dust that feeds their growth. Other pink dots may be objects that lie well behind these galaxies, including extremely distant active supermassive black holes known as quasars.
The largest, brightest pink region that glimmers with eight prominent diffraction spikes at the bottom right is a mini starburst — a location where many stars are forming in quick succession. Find the lace-like holes in the spiral arms. These areas are brimming with star formation.
Finally, scan the black background of space, where objects shine brightly in a rainbow of colors. Blue circles with tiny diffraction spikes are foreground stars. Objects without spikes are very distant galaxies.

Image Details
| About The Object | |
|---|---|
| Object Name | IC 2163 and NGC 2207 |
| Object Description | Spiral Galaxies |
| R.A. Position | 06:16:24.9 |
| Dec. Position | -21:22:26 |
| Constellation | Canis Major |
| Distance | 114 million light-years |
| Dimensions | The image is about 4.7 arcminutes across (about 156,000 light-years) |
| About The Data | |
| Data Description | This image was created with Webb data from proposal 6553 (M. Garcia Marin). Image Processing: Joseph DePasquale (STScI) |
| Instrument | MIRI |
| Exposure Dates | January 26, February 2, 2024 |
| Filters | F750W, F1130W, F1500W |
| About The Image | |
| Color Info | These images are a composite of separate exposures acquired by the James Webb Space Telescope using the MIRI instrument. Several filters were used to sample wide wavelength ranges. The color results from assigning different hues (colors) to each monochromatic (grayscale) image associated with an individual filter. In this case, the assigned colors are: Blue: F750W Green: F1130W Red: F1500W |
